New York Court of Appeals
The People of the State of New York, Appellant v. Abel Rosas, Respondent
May 8, 20078 N.Y.3d 493
Summary
The Court affirmed that the two first‑degree murder convictions arising from the same criminal transaction must be served concurrently under Penal Law § 70.25(2). The People failed to meet their burden of showing the sentences could be consecutive. Justice Graffeo dissented, arguing the consecutive sentences were lawful.
